Movie Review: Simply awesome
Summary: 5 Stars

Ok first things first - don't believe everything you read in other reviews about this new version of the We Will Rock You DVD. The audio and video quality is awesome, and while the concert isn't classic Queen, it is the only DVD available so far of a live performance by a great band.

There are no sync problems between the audio and video, and the reason why the band doesn't perform the middle section of Bohemian Rhapsody live is very simple - Queen never performed that part on stage. It was so complex that they always played a tape recording of it while they went offstage to change costumes and freshen up.

If you don't own a full-blown home theatre set-up, don't despair. This DVD has a killer stereo track that rocks.

As for the songs, they are all drawn from the older albums. The concert features such strong tracks as Save Me, Play The Game, I'm in Love With My Car, Under Pressure and Somebody To Love.

The biggest drawback with this concert seems to be the audience, they don't seem to be familiar with the music of Queen, and one of the highpoints of a Queen concert was Freddie's interaction with the fans. For that, I guess we will have to wait for the release on DVD of classic concerts like Live in Rio and Live in Budapest.

If you like Queen and their music, just go do yourself a favour - get this DVD, put it into the player, turn up the volume and enjoy!!

Movie Review: Queen DVD Comparison
Summary: 4 Stars

Ok here's my comparison of the 4 Queen concert DVDs.

Live Aid: By far the best, but shortest. Only 20 minutes or so of Queen, but great songs, incredible crowd energy, and transcendent performance by a certain lead singer.

On Fire At the Bowl: Second best because of a great performance, great audio mix, and great crowd energy. The crowd even sings in tune!

We Will Rock You: Third. Great performance, and highest-quality video, but the crowd energy was pathetic. Also, on louder songs, the audio mix is inconsistent.

Live At Wembley: Last, because it's too depressing. The crowd energy seemed good, but Freddy has a lot less vocal power and range than earlier, and frankly he looks sick and weak. Maybe he was just under the weather that day, but I'm afraid it was due to the illness that would take his life a few years later. Also, I'm not a fan of the super-fast editing of this show, but mainly I just couldn't bear to watch this after seeing Freddy so strong and powerful in the earlier shows.
